**Q: ShrinkRay CLI won't start — says its config vault is sealed. What do I do?**

Happens after a machine restart. ShrinkRay keeps resize presets in an encrypted vault, and it needs unsealing before batch jobs run. Don't reinstall — you'll lose the Pellworth presets. Just unseal it with the recovery passphrase written right below:

strongbox words: fenwyn-lamix-novael-holeth-sorix-druael-lamwyn

TICKET-4412: Proctorline exam queue failing in staging

Severity: high. The Proctorline queue workers reject every incoming exam session with a credential error. Root cause: the staging `.env` was copied from the demo cluster and the broker secret was dropped during the merge. Sessions pile up, invigilators see timeouts. Fix is one line. Rotate the demo value out first, confirm with the Kestrelbay ops channel, then redeploy. The corrected env file must include the following line.

vault entry, kafog-yahop: COURIER_KEY8=0faa53ae

## Tuning

The Quarrow renderer batches invoice pages before rasterizing. Plugin authors: don't fight the batcher. If your plugin injects large assets, raise the memory ceiling rather than shrinking batch size — shrinking batches tanks throughput on multi-page runs. Font caching is on by default; disable only if you ship per-invoice fonts. All values can be overridden in your plugin manifest, but overrides are validated at load time and rejected if out of range. Defaults are listed below.

tuning table, kajog-bawip:
TIERS = {
    "kelius": 256,
    "lammir": 543,
}

**Q: When should I accept updated snapshots in a Glimmerkit UI review?**

Only when the diff matches an intentional visual change described in the PR. Bulk snapshot updates with no explanation should be rejected. Watch for font-rendering noise from local runs — snapshots must come from the CI renderer, never a developer machine. If more than ten components change in one PR, request screenshots. The reviewer checklist, known flaky components, and approved baseline procedure are documented on the internal page below.

dashboard of tawef-yageg = https://jira.torvaworks.corp/deploy/merge_requests/board/settings/issue/settings/build/86c86b97dff3e2041bd6f497